5 Steps to Overcoming Tongue-Tied Pronunciation
Now that we have a basic understanding of the mechanics involved, let us proceed to the 5 actionable steps necessary to overcome even the most daunting linguistic obstacles:
Step 1: Start with the Basics
Before tackling tricky words, make sure to have a solid foundation in the sounds and pronunciation of individual letters. This includes understanding the different diacritical marks used to indicate changes in pronunciation, such as the acute accent (á) or the umlaut (ü). By mastering the fundamental sounds of language, you will be better equipped to tackle more complex words.
Step 2: Break Down Unfamiliar Words
When encountering a new word with multiple syllables or complex consonant combinations, try breaking it down into its individual parts. This can help you focus on specific sounds and improve your overall pronunciation. For instance, by analyzing the sounds of the individual syllables within a word, you can begin to build up a mental representation of how the word should be pronounced.
Step 3: Practice Regularly
Consistency is key when it comes to improving your pronunciation. Set aside dedicated time each day to practice speaking and listening to unfamiliar words. Whether through language learning apps, YouTube tutorials, or conversing with native speakers, make sure to challenge yourself regularly and track your progress.
Step 4: Focus on Articulation
Pronunciation is closely tied to articulation, which refers to the way words are formed using the mouth, tongue, and lips. Practice articulating individual sounds, including consonant blends and vowel combinations. This will help you develop muscle memory and improve your overall ability to pronounce unfamiliar words.
Step 5: Seek Feedback and Guidance
Surround yourself with people who are fluent in the language you are trying to improve. Seek feedback from native speakers or experienced language instructors, and be open to constructive criticism. By embracing guidance and actively seeking out feedback, you can accelerate your progress and gain a deeper understanding of the intricacies of pronunciation.
